A 38-year-old woman with diminished ovarian reserve and a history of failed IVF attempts became pregnant after just three months of acupuncture. Her case, published as a single-patient report, also showed improvements in hormone levels, egg count, and menopause-like symptoms.
Doctors measured her antral follicle count (a marker of egg supply) and sex hormone levels before and after treatment. Both improved. Her score on the Modified Kupperman Index, which tracks symptoms like hot flashes and mood changes, also got better.
But this is just one person's story. There was no comparison group, so we can't say for sure that acupuncture caused the changes. It's possible other factors played a role. And we don't know if the benefits lasted beyond the three months.
Still, the result is striking. For someone who had given up hope after repeated IVF failures, this case offers a glimmer. But much more research is needed before we can recommend acupuncture as a treatment for low ovarian reserve.
